Mysterious Symbols Could Represent The Earliest Writing Ever Found  Live Science - January 12, 2023

Researchers say they have discovered what they call a "proto-writing system" embedded in 20,000-year-old cave paintings, making it the earliest form of some sort of writing we've ever found. Hunters from the Upper Palaeolithic era would have used the symbols daubed on the walls to pass on essential survival information: The researchers suggest they show a record of animal mating seasons, organized by the lunar months. It's a significant finding because it pushes back the earliest form of Homo sapiens writing by around 14,000 years. Although we're not looking at letters and sentences here, these markings do represent "a complete unit of meaning"
